#61936e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#61936e is composed of 38% red, 57.6% green and 43.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34% cyan, 0% magenta, 25.2% yellow and 42.4% black. It has a hue angle of 135.6 degrees, a saturation of 20.5% and a lightness of 47.8%. #61936e color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ffdc with #002700.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#61936e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030504 is the darkest color, while #f8fbf9 is the lightest one.
